Nomura Overview:
Nomura is a global financial services group with an integrated network spanning approximately 30 countries and regions. By connecting markets East & West, Nomura services the needs of individuals, institutions, corporates and governments through its three business divisions: Wealth Management, Investment Management, and Wholesale (Global Markets and Investment Banking). Founded in 1925, the firm is built on a tradition of disciplined entrepreneurship, serving clients with creative solutions and considered thought leadership. Divisional Overview:
Powai Finance is an integral part of the CFO division and plays a key role in various Finance functions ranging from Treasury, Global Middle Office, Financial Control & Regulatory Reporting, Global Infrastructure, Cost Analytics and MI. Located strategically to cater to multiple time zones, Powai Finance ensures internal and regulatory deliverables across all regions are supported
Business Overview:
MI team in Mumbai is an extension of the Global MI team providing Analytical and Quantitative Support to the onshore teams. Team caters to MIS requirements of senior management across Nomura Wholesale (Global Markets, IBD divisions) and regions (Japan, AeJ, EMEA and US). Team is responsible for daily, weekly and monthly reporting of Revenues, Expenses and other financial resources.
Within MI, Wholesale R&A team caters to MIS requirements of senior management of Nomura’s Global Markets division. The team is comprised of dedicated regional groups based in Powai supporting Global stakeholders in Europe, Asia-Ex, Japan and US.
